Bryson DeChambeau finished off a dramatic Championship Sunday in South Africa by winning the individual title in a playoff over Jon Rahm after both players ended regulation tied at 26-under par. The final round had pressure from every direction. Dean Burmester gave the home fans immediate hope with birdies on his first two holes to surge into contention, while Brandon Grace kept the South African charge alive with a series of clutch shots and a vital birdie at the 14th. David Puig also stayed in the mix with several sharp wedge shots and timely birdies as the leaderboard stayed packed for much of the day. The biggest duel, though, became DeChambeau versus Rahm. Bryson grabbed control with a run of three straight birdies early and kept the crowd engaged with another birdie at the ninth as he tried to hold off Rahm’s charge. Rahm steadily built momentum, birdieing the ninth, making eagle at the 10th to pull within one, then continuing his surge with another huge birdie at the 16th to draw level. He nearly stole the outright lead with a strong birdie try at the 17th, then posted 26-under after a closing birdie chance on the 18th left him tied at the top and waiting to see if Bryson could answer. DeChambeau did answer, and he did it while also leading Crushers GC to the team title in one of the tightest finishes of the week. With rain, mud, and waterlogged conditions adding even more pressure late, Bryson made the key birdie he needed to force the playoff and seal the team championship as well. In the extra hole, he produced the shot of the day from a muddy lie, a remarkable recovery that set up the winning chance. Rahm, after taking relief from casual water, could not match it, and DeChambeau calmly finished the job. It was another statement win for Bryson, who followed his Singapore playoff victory with yet another clutch Sunday finish, while Crushers GC edged the Southern Guards by a single shot in the team race.
